  • Abstract
    This paper highlights the design, simulation, analysis and fabrication of a coaxial-fed rectangular spiral microstrip antenna (RSMA) for Wi-Fi application. The centre frequency is 2.45 GHz and the bandwidth is 22 MHz. The radiation pattern of this RSMA illustrated an omni-directional pattern with voltage standing wave ratio of less than two (2), return loss of less than -10 dB, the line impedance of 50 Ω and gain of 5 dBi. All the design and simulation of this RSMA were carried by using a commercial 3-D electromagnetic simulator. The prototype was fabricated on FR 4 substrate with 4.9 dielectric constant and 1.54 mm of thickness. Vector network analyzer ZVA40 was used to measure all the parameters of this RSMA. The 2D radiation pattern was obtained by using antenna training system ED3200. It was observed that the simulated and measured values of the parameters of the RSMA were quite close with each other.
